Output 51d59ae6241fc9749b36d0999444ed06d1e61db0da211475ad9d6099ae0294f7:0

value
16936494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e9d94637c0326d4454b3d5f587159135288a110 OP_EQUAL
address
37Q6bGCFbcKxmLwQn9kBoyrNNfDZTPQdCh
transaction
51d59ae6241fc9749b36d0999444ed06d1e61db0da211475ad9d6099ae0294f7
spent
true